WebThe normal “g" (Unicode+0067) has a loop tail only in fonts with serifs; in sans serif fonts the normal g is open tailed and Unicode+0067 and Unicode+0261 look identical. However, if … WebAug 31, 2024 · Like with all the sounds in English it cn be spelled in many different ways because the language is not phonetic. The /g/ phoneme is normally spelled with the letter ‘g’ as in the words: good /gʊd/. girl /gɜːl/. But surprisingly it can also be spelt with the letter ‘x’ as in the words: As in the words: exactly /ɪgˈzæktli/.
